Abstract

Letters to Cecil Burghley, Lord Treasurer of England, to obtain the position of Customer Inwards at Bristol for John Dowle, on the resignation of William Hulbert.

Bibliographical note

Additional information: The following conventions were employed when transcribing these documents: the line spacing, spelling, capitalization, punctuation and underlining follow the manuscript; reconstructions of suspensions are in italics, editorial comments are in squared brackets.
